LPNS and LVNs: A Potential On-Ramp to a Satisfying Nursing Career

Daily Nurse

LPNs attend a 12 to 18-month educational non-degree diploma program and then sit for the NCLEX-PN national licensing exam. Bureau of Labor Statistics , in 2023, LPNs earned a median annual salary of $59,730 per year or $28.72 per hour, with 3% projected job growth (as fast as the average) from 2023 to 2033.
